The us edition of making bombs for hitler was made available in february through retail outlets and libraries in hardcover, and in paperback through scholastic s school book clubs and book fairs, and includes a nazi swastika as part of its cover design. Mar 07, 2012 making bombs for hitler begins in the aftermath of raids of ukrainians kidnapped and transported to nazi germany as slave labour, known as ostarbeiters. Nov 29, 2016 making bombs for hitler by marsha forchuk skrypuch after the nazis shoot their mother and the jews she had been hiding, lida, 8, and her younger sister larissa, 5, are kidnapped from their grandmothers home in the ukraine and sent by cattle car to germany, along with all the other ukrainian children the nazis took.
